The Dodge Spirit is a midsize car from 1990, equipped with a 2.5L engine running on premium gasoline. It features an automatic 3-speed transmission, offering straightforward driving for everyday use. While compact by today's standards, its practical design provides ample space for passengers and cargo.

What are common problems with the Dodge Spirit?
Common issues include transmission reliability due to its older 3-speed automatic, rust on the body, and engine performance quirks. Regular maintenance is key to keeping it running smoothly.
Is the Dodge Spirit fuel-efficient?
No, the Dodge Spirit is not very fuel-efficient by modern standards. Its 2.5L engine and 3-speed automatic transmission result in lower gas mileage compared to newer cars.
How reliable is the Dodge Spirit for daily driving?
While the Dodge Spirit was reliable for its time, its age now means it may require more frequent repairs. If well-maintained, it can still serve as a daily driver, but newer cars may be more dependable.
Is the Dodge Spirit easy to park and maneuver?
Yes, its midsize design makes it relatively easy to park and maneuver, which can be appealing for drivers who prefer a balanced car size.
